Output 631620b454ff8b8ba714df3bf9b3baf265a0634dcbb4f4afc4ae82fa85f5fe50:0

value
19895718
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c68ba9d7ba6985679f65b3cb2baa04347bf41ae OP_EQUAL
address
3JsERJanpMdM8jQK1ZCRBLukcMVKx5ySPh
transaction
631620b454ff8b8ba714df3bf9b3baf265a0634dcbb4f4afc4ae82fa85f5fe50
confirmations
406215
spent
true